The Lymow One is a robot lawnmower with a high coverage area for larger lawns, one that also uses satellite navigation and onboard mapping systems to know where it is in your garden without a perimeter wire.

Originally a successful Kickstarter campaign that raised over $3.5 million, Lymow has enhanced its offering to create the new Lymow One. An advanced robot lawnmower with quite a few smart features.

Its Dual Blade Mowing Deck is designed to work with multiple types of grass, with the use of two high-speed spinning mulching blades and a centrifugal fan. The system cuts clippings while avoiding clumping to nourish the lawn, while also distributing the clippings evenly.

Using a brushless motor with a peak output of 1,200W, it can spin the blades at up to 6,000 RPM, with a cutting width of 16 inches. The terrain-adaptive floating deck can adjust from 1.2 inches to 4 inches, while its omniwheels follow the ground across uneven terrain.

The LySee Multi-Fusion navigation system uses a combination of real-time kinematic (RTK) satellite positioning as well as visual simultaneous localization and mapping (VSLAM) to know where it is with centimeter-level precision. While RTK signals can be affected by trees, bad weather, and other environmental factors, VSLAM can handle times when the satellite is not available.

The VSLAM system uses stereo cameras with image-based semantic recognition and depth-sensing to understand its surroundings. Its onboard processing can also adapt to obstacles, including pet waste, animals, and sprinklers, avoiding them if necessary, as defined in the Lymow app.

It also has five ultrasonic sensors, two front bumpers, and off-ground sensors in the blade deck for safety. It can stop the blades within a second once it detects a hazardous situation.

Lymow has also made it a speedy mower, with it able to cover 0.23 acres an hour, 0.57 acres per charge, or 1.73 acres per day. Its traction allows it to handle obstacles up to two inches in height, 45-degree slopes, and even some staircases.

Built to be rugged, it is made from a one-piece die-cast aluminum alloy frame, as well as an IPX6 waterproof rating.

The Lymow One is in production, with delivery expected from April 2025. It is priced at $2,999.

Mixed martial arts (MMA) continues to be the strangest sport in the world.

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) Middleweight Sedriques Dumas returns to action after going 1-1 in 2024 at UFC 311 in two weeks (Sat., Jan. 18, 2024) against knockout artist Zach Reese, which is set to go down inside Intuit Dome in Inglewood (Los Angeles), California.

However, before Dumas collides with his opponent, he might have something to take care of … fight a Rollin 40s Crip.

Recently, on the No Jumper Podcast, Rollin 40s Crip 4Xtra doubled down and said he’d fight and beat up any UFC fighter (we’ve heard this before).

“So you ruffled some feathers last time we were together because you said that you would whoop the sh-t out of a UFC heavyweight, and a lot of UFC fighters were not a fan of this, and they want to challenge you,” Adam22 told 4Xtra.

4xtra responded with, “All right, hurry up and set it up. I’ve been waiting on this. Set the f—king thing up. I’m about to put him up. That’s the cold part about it. See, that’s the thing about UFC fighters. They think they gonna win because they got a paper showing that you are a UFC fighter. Because you got accepted to the UFC, that doesn’t mean you gonna win. You get it? You think you’re just gonna beat a dude that fights on the street or fights in jail?

“I see people who are boxers get knocked out. You get what I’m saying? So don’t matter what he is talking about on that; make sure he has a bag, and I’m gonna put his ass out. And when I put him out, I want another $100,000 for putting him out. Set this up now.”

Maybe he saw B.J. Penn get knocked out in a bar fight.

Nevertheless, Adam22 mentioned Dumas’s name and said he would be more than willing to fight the gang member.

Last night (Jan. 4, 2025), “The Reaper” responded to 4Xtra’s open challenge and accepted a fight.

“Put who out,” Dumas wrote on his Instagram story. “Boy let me know when you ready.”

When Are the 2025 Golden Globes?

The Golden Globes will take place on Sunday, January 5, 2025, at the Beverly Hilton in Beverly Hills, California.

How to Watch the 2025 Golden Globes on Cable

The award show will air on CBS, the event’s official broadcast partner.

Can You Stream the 2025 Golden Globes?

Yes! If cable is not your preferred way to watch, you can stream the Golden Globes on the CBS app by signing in with your credentials. It will also stream live on Paramount+, though you’ll need either a premium subscription to watch in real time or a regular subscription to access it on Monday, January 6, 2025.
